⚡ Why Real-Time Features Matter in Today’s Web Applications
In an era where users expect lightning-fast responses and seamless interactivity, real-time features are no longer a luxury—they're a necessity. Whether you're building a chat app, live tracking dashboard, multiplayer game, or collaborative tool, real-time web technologies can dramatically enhance user engagement and satisfaction.
In this blog post, we’ll explore why real-time features matter more than ever, what technologies make them possible, and how they’re shaping the future of web development.
Real-time features refer to functionalities where information is updated immediately across users or devices without needing to refresh the page.

Today’s users are accustomed to apps like WhatsApp, Uber, or Google Docs that provide live updates. A delayed interface can make your app feel outdated.
Real-time functionality builds trust and transparency, especially in mission-critical systems like delivery or banking.
Live features such as typing indicators, read receipts, or live comments make users feel connected and involved—reducing bounce rates and increasing session time.
In team-based tools like Trello, Slack, or Notion, real-time syncing avoids version conflicts and improves productivity.
Real-time updates help teams stay in sync without extra communication.
In sectors like finance, logistics, or eCommerce, real-time dashboards and alerts enable immediate responses to changes, saving time and money.
Adding real-time features can differentiate your app from competitors, especially in industries that rely heavily on speed and interactivity.
Real-time functionality requires a persistent connection between the client and the server to instantly push updates.
| Technology | Description |
|---|---|
| WebSockets | Bi-directional, full-duplex communication between browser and server |
| Socket.IO | JavaScript library built on WebSockets with fallback options |
| Pusher | Real-time messaging as a service (Pub/Sub system) |
| Firebase Realtime DB / Firestore | Serverless backend offering automatic syncing |
| Laravel Echo + Redis + Pusher | Real-time broadcasting stack in Laravel |
| GraphQL Subscriptions | Real-time data with GraphQL APIs |

While powerful, real-time features come with complexity:
Scalability: Handling thousands of concurrent connections can strain your server.
Security: Real-time data can be sensitive (especially in finance/chat).
Sync Conflicts: Multiple users editing the same data can create conflicts.
Bandwidth: Pushing too many updates too frequently can bloat your app.
Choosing the right stack and implementing throttling, caching, and rate limiting is essential.
If you’re looking to build real-time features into your Laravel-based app, here’s a proven stack:
Laravel + Laravel Echo
Redis / Socket.IO / Pusher
Vue.js or React on Frontend
Broadcast events with queues for scalability
Want to go serverless? Firebase’s Realtime Database or Firestore offers powerful syncing capabilities with less backend setup.
